1880: Trials and Tribulations of the Constable

As can be seen in the article above, the Constable's job was not a walk in the park. Apparently he was much like the "repo" man we see on numerous television shows. Instead of repossing automobiles, he is charged with taking back homes, furniture, and any other possessions which were not paid for.

1930: SOUTHERN AREA OF HAMILTON LACKS WATER

I HAVE ALWAYS WONDERED WHY SOME ENTERPRISING ORGANIZATION DIDN'T HARNESS THE WATER FROM THE NATURAL SPRINGS AT HAMILTON TOWNSHIP'S PORTION OF SPRING LAKE AT WHITE CITY. THERE WAS AN ATTEMPT TO DO JUST THAT BACK IN THE 1800'S, BUT FOR SOME REASON THE PROJECT WAS ABANDONED. PERHAPS A TRENTON-HAMILTON-BORDENTOWN MARSH PERSON KNOWS THE ANSWER. THERE WAS SUPPOSEDLY AN ETERNAL SUPPLY OF SPRING WATER JUST WAITING TO BE PROCESSED.
